Age of Empires II: Definitive Edition has officially launched on Mac after seven years of anticipation, delivering updated high-resolution visuals and extensive historical campaigns to Apple Silicon devices. The release includes bundled expansion packs but restricts online multiplayer exclusively to macOS users, requiring players to verify system compatibility before purchase or download the software.

Feral Interactive has undertaken the complex task of adapting this extensive strategy title for macOS, ensuring compatibility with current hardware architectures while preserving the original gameplay mechanics. The studio is well known for its meticulous approach to porting legacy software, carefully translating codebases to function smoothly on modern operating systems. This particular release requires players to utilize Steam as the primary distribution platform, with a subsequent Mac App Store launch scheduled for later in two thousand twenty six. Developers have prioritized stability and performance optimization throughout the adaptation process.

The game spans approximately one millennium of European and Asian history, allowing participants to command various civilizations across distinct historical epochs. Players can guide legendary figures through meticulously researched campaigns that reconstruct pivotal military engagements from antiquity through the mediaeval period. Each faction possesses unique technological advantages and specialized units that fundamentally alter tactical approaches during extended matches. This structural diversity ensures that repeated playthroughs yield different strategic challenges, encouraging continuous adaptation and long-term engagement with the historical material presented throughout the campaign mode.

Hardware requirements have fundamentally changed since the original release, with modern players needing devices equipped with Apple Silicon processors to run the software effectively. Intel-based machines are explicitly unsupported, reflecting a broader industry transition toward custom silicon architectures that prioritize efficiency and parallel processing capabilities. Gamers must verify their device specifications before initiating downloads or purchases, as system compatibility directly impacts performance stability during extended tactical engagements. The technical foundation ensures consistent frame rates and rapid asset loading across high-resolution displays.

Content expansion distinguishes this version from earlier iterations, bundling three major downloadable content packages that introduce additional civilizations and historical scenarios. These supplementary materials significantly extend the base game duration while providing fresh strategic variables for experienced players to analyze. How does the multiplayer ecosystem function on macOS?

Online connectivity remains a critical component of real-time strategy gaming, yet this particular release introduces specific networking limitations for Apple users. The matchmaking infrastructure exclusively supports cross-play between other Mac devices, deliberately excluding compatibility with personal computer counterparts. This restriction creates a segmented competitive environment where players must coordinate with others using identical operating systems to participate in ranked or casual matches. Developers have acknowledged this limitation while emphasizing the stability of the macOS network stack during concurrent gameplay sessions.

Cooperative modes follow similar platform boundaries, requiring all participants to utilize compatible hardware and software configurations before attempting shared campaign objectives. The technical architecture prioritizes connection reliability over broad cross-platform accessibility, ensuring that latency remains manageable for tactical decision-making. Players seeking collaborative historical scenarios must verify their network environment and device specifications prior to initiating multiplayer sessions. This approach maintains consistent performance standards across the supported ecosystem while acknowledging the current limitations of distributed matchmaking infrastructure.

Graphics enhancement requires a separate free download that must be installed independently from the core game files. This additional step ensures compatibility with high-resolution displays while maintaining optimal performance on standard monitors. Users should anticipate this installation process during initial setup to avoid confusion regarding missing visual assets or texture loading delays. The updated rendering pipeline successfully scales across various display configurations, delivering crisp unit models and detailed environmental textures that enhance immersion without imposing excessive hardware demands on compatible systems.

How does resource management function in practice?

Economic development forms the foundation of every successful military campaign within this historical simulation framework. Players begin each scenario with a small group of civilian units tasked with exploring surrounding territories and harvesting essential materials such as timber, stone, gold, and agricultural produce. These collected resources directly fund construction projects ranging from defensive fortifications to advanced research facilities. Managing supply chains efficiently requires constant monitoring of population growth and infrastructure expansion while simultaneously defending against hostile incursions that threaten economic stability.

Technological progression follows a structured tree system that unlocks progressively powerful military units and defensive capabilities as campaigns advance through distinct historical ages. Advancing from the dark age into subsequent eras demands significant resource investment and careful timing to avoid leaving settlements vulnerable during transition periods. Universities and specialized buildings facilitate scientific research that yields permanent tactical advantages across multiple engagements. Players must balance immediate military needs against long-term technological goals, creating dynamic strategic dilemmas that define the core gameplay loop.

Skirmish mode offers an alternative framework where participants design custom battles against computer-controlled opponents across selectable terrain configurations. This sandbox environment encourages experimentation with unconventional faction combinations and tactical strategies without the pressure of historical campaign constraints. Up to seven artificial intelligence adversaries provide varying difficulty levels that adapt to player performance over time. The mode serves as a practical testing ground for refining economic pipelines and military compositions before attempting more challenging multiplayer encounters or complex historical scenarios.
